Humphrey Cemetery
Humphrey Cemetery is a cemetery in Town of Holland, Erie County, New York. Humphrey Cemetery is situated nearby to the village Holland.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Holland
Village
Holland is a town in Erie County, New York, United States. The population was 3,281 at the 2020 census. The name is derived from the Holland Land Company, the original title-holder to most of the land of Western New York. Holland is situated 2½ miles south of Humphrey Cemetery.
Strykersville
Village
Strykersville is a hamlet located within the town of Sheldon, with a small southern portion in the Town of Java, in the western part of Wyoming County, New York, United States. Strykersville is situated 6 miles east of Humphrey Cemetery.
